Hi all.... Just looking for some info from anyone who has fitted 13" wheels and tyres. I have done some measurements with a tape and it appears a 165/60 will just fit the rear, but a 175/60 will foul on the subframe. I really want to go 175 but need to know if anyone has fitted that size successfully. Thanks in advance for any info folks..

13inch wheel will need a 175/50/13 tyre

175/50/13 = 505mm rolling diameter

175/60/13 = 540mm

A 165/60 is 528mm rolling diameter. That will need guard surgury at the front.
Normally I'd say they a poofteenth too big but they might work.
Let us know how you get on, since 175/50s are tricky to get.
:D

Edit: If you are looking at the DZ02G (only 165/60/13 I noticed) then note its maximum rim width is suggested at only 5 inches.
Most 13" wheels are 5.5 inches wide.

I haven't bought rims, that will be a little further down the track, a lot of other work building the car, I used to rally minis in the '70s and the rear tyres are not as important as the front end, there isn't much weight over them to have to control, in fact a little less traction is often desirable to get the back to move when you want it to.

How competition are we talking?

Yokohama do the A048R in a 175/50R13 which is a bloody good tire and suitable for tarmac rallies.
